Proposed Development
Installation of 6 telecommunications antenna together with supporting structures, RRU's equipment cabinet at roof top level to provide mobile electronic communications services and all associated site works.

Three storey mixed use building at the site (with four storey element at entrance) having a gross floor area of 6,065 m2. The proposal also includes the development of an urban square, green area, car-parking and associated site works. The development will in part modify the previously granted planning permission issued under registered reference SD03A/0648 that received a final grant on 18 December 2003. The amendments made by this proposal to the original development approved under SD03A/0648 include a revised layout of the urban square, a revised layout of the site's internal road and also amendments to the approved car-parking layout. The proposed mixed use building will provide for the delivery of a range of services for people with intellectual disability including adult/vocational education, clinical observation/consultation and requisite staffing administration/support areas. In addition the centre will provide canteen facilities and simulated retail/workshop environments on the ground floor.
